-5- Example:- For X.3082. R.R. Standard Starter Motor. 10^5 b / Z P = (10^5 x 2) / (90 x 4) = 10^4 / 18 ℓ = 10^5 / 3 = 10^4 / 25.36 = 394 TN = ℓ e C = 84.5 e C At 100 amperes :- Torque on brake test = 47.5 lb-inches, whence Φr = 394 x .475 = 187 kilolines. Torque on static torque test = 54.0 lb-inches. whence Φs = 394 x .540 = 213 kilolines. Volts/Speed on E.M.F. test = .00875 whence Φe = 675 / 3 = 225 kilolines. Terminal volts on brake test = 9.80 Speed " " " = 1130 R.P.M. whence ΦE = (10^5 / 3) x (9.80 / 1130) = 289 kilolines. ηe = Φs / ΦE = .737, ηm = Φr / Φs = .878. η = ηe ηm = .647, ηa = Φs / Φe = .947.
